
I won’t indulge in factional politics and backstabbing: DKS
The Hindu
A day after a breakfast meeting with Chief Minister Siddaramaiah that has, for now, paused the talk on leadership and rotation of power in Karnataka Congress, Deputy Chief Minister D.K. Shivakumar on Sunday said that he would not indulge in “factional politics” and “backstabbing”. He also claimed that he had no differences with the Chief Minister.
